Creating effective lead magnets

Lead magnets are a crucial element of any successful sales funnel.

They are designed to attract potential customers and encourage them to provide their contact information, thereby becoming a lead.

Lead magnets can take many forms, such as e-books, webinars, whitepapers, and more.

The goal is to provide value to the prospect in exchange for their contact information, thereby starting the process of building a relationship with them.

Why Lead Magnets are Important

Lead magnets are an essential part of any sales funnel because they help to build trust and establish a relationship with potential customers.

When a prospect provides their contact information in exchange for a valuable piece of content, they are demonstrating a level of interest in the product or service being offered.

This interest can then be nurtured through a series of follow-up communications, eventually leading to a sale.

How to Create Effective Lead Magnets

Creating an effective lead magnet requires careful planning and execution.

Here are the steps involved:

Step 1: Identify Your Target Audience

The first step in creating an effective lead magnet is to identify your target audience.

Who are you trying to reach? What are their pain points, needs, and desires? Understanding your audience is crucial to creating a lead magnet that will resonate with them.

Step 2: Determine Your Offer

Once you have identified your target audience, the next step is to determine what offer you will provide.

This could be an e-book, a webinar, a free trial, or any other valuable piece of content that will entice your audience to provide their contact information.

Step 3: Create Your Content

With your target audience and offer in mind, it’s time to create your content.

This could involve writing an e-book, creating a webinar presentation, or producing a video.

The key is to provide value to your audience and demonstrate your expertise in your field.

Step 4: Design Your Lead Capture Form

The next step is to design your lead capture form.

This is the form that your audience will fill out in exchange for your offer.

Keep the form simple and straightforward, asking only for the information you need to follow up with the lead.

Step 5: Promote Your Lead Magnet

Once your lead magnet is created and your lead capture form is designed, it’s time to promote your offer.

This could involve promoting it on social media, through email marketing, or by placing it on your website.

Step 6: Follow Up with Your Leads

The final step in creating an effective lead magnet is to follow up with your leads.

This involves sending a series of follow-up communications that provide additional value and demonstrate your expertise.

The goal is to nurture the relationship with the lead and eventually convert them into a customer.

Best Practices for Success

Here are some best practices for creating effective lead magnets:

  • Focus on providing value to your audience
  • Keep your lead capture form simple and straightforward
  • Promote your lead magnet across multiple channels
  • Follow up with your leads in a timely and consistent manner
  • Monitor your results and adjust your strategy as needed
  • Continuously test and optimize your lead magnet for maximum effectiveness

Examples of Successful Lead Magnets

Example 1: Local Fitness Studio

A local fitness studio created an e-book titled “10 Tips for Getting Fit at Home.” They promoted the e-book on their website and social media channels and collected leads through a simple lead capture form.

They followed up with the leads through a series of emails that provided additional fitness tips and eventually converted many of them into paying members.

Example 2: Online Marketing Agency

An online marketing agency created a free webinar titled “5 Secrets to Boosting Your Online Presence.” They promoted the webinar on their website and social media channels and collected leads through a lead capture form.

They followed up with the leads through a series of emails that provided additional marketing tips and eventually converted many of them into paying clients.
